Ecovía is a bus rapid transit (BRT) system in Monterrey, Nuevo Leon that began operations in January 2014.

Overview

As of 2014 Ecovía consists of a single route that runs 30 kilometers serving three different municipalities of the Monterrey Metropolitan area: Monterrey, San Nicolas and Guadalupe.[1]

Ecovía buses operate within a fully dedicated right of way (busway). Buses offer free wifi access.

Ecovía stations include off-board fare collection and platform level with the bus floor.
